The application of artificial intelligence in waste management: understanding the potential of data-driven approaches for the circular economy paradigm

Abstract:
Purpose – Our study examines how artificial intelligence (AI) can enhance decision-making processes to promote circular economy practices within the utility sector.
Design/methodology/approach – A unique case study of Alia Servizi Ambientali Spa, an Italian multi- utility company using AI for waste management, is analyzed using the Gioia method and semi-structured interviews.
Findings – Our study discovers the proactive role of the user in waste management processes, the importance of economic incentives to increase the usefulness of the technology and the role of AI in waste management transformation processes (e.g. glass waste).
Originality/value – The present study enhances the circular economy model (transformation, distribution and recovery), uncovering AI’s role in waste management. Finally, we inspire managers with algorithms used for data-driven decisions.
